Chidambaram is a significant temple town in Tamil Nadu. It is famous for the Thillai Nataraja Tem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va as the cosmic dancer. This ancient temple is a major pilgrimage site and a marvel of Chola architecture.

Attur is a small town in Salem district, Tamil Nadu. It is known for its historical fort, ancient temples, and a thriving agricultural and textile economy. You will find a glimpse into traditional Tamil life here, away from major tourist crowds.

Where to Eat in Salem: Local Cuisine Guide
Must-Try Dishes in Salem
Don't leave Salem without tasting these local specialties:
- Salem Thattu Vadai Set - A unique street food snack with crispy vadai, grated carrots, beetroot, and chutneys. Get it from any street vendor near the bus stand, rupees 40-60.
- Kongu Style Biryani - A spicy, flavorful biryani made with short-grain rice and local spices, often with chicken or mutton. Try it at Selvi Mess, rupees 200-350.
- Idli and Dosa - Staple South Indian breakfast items, served with various chutneys and sambar. Available at any local tiffin center, rupees 30-80.
- Filter Coffee - Strong, frothy South Indian coffee, a must-try after any meal. Available at most restaurants and small cafes, rupees 20-40.
- Aappam with Coconut Milk - Soft, lacy rice pancakes served with sweet coconut milk or a savory stew. Find it at traditional South Indian restaurants, rupees 80-150.
- Kuzhi Paniyaram - Savory or sweet steamed rice and lentil dumplings, often served with chutney. Available at tiffin centers, rupees 50-100.

👕 What to Wear
Light, breathable cotton clothing is recommended due to the warm climate. For temple visits, ensure your shoulders and knees are covered. Footwear must be removed before entering temples.
